Background technology
Stator coil is one of important composition part of three phase electric machine, and the coil of conventional three-phase motor mainly by entering by hand Row coiling, first by coil winding on mould when actually used, then mould unloading again, workload is big, and low production efficiency is wasted big The manpower of amount and powerless, and the number of turns precision of hand wound is poor, in order to solve this problem, is developed various stators The coil winding machine of coil, but these coil winding machines be all merely able to every time around a stator coil, winding efficiency is low, at the same its processing effect Rate cannot still meet actual process requirements.So specially devise a kind of automatic coil winding machine, automatic coil winding machine operationally, Need to position motor stator and automatically can also be cut off copper cash after the completion of coiling, and there are currently no specifically designed for this The mechanism of individual demand.

Specific embodiment
Below in conjunction with the accompanying drawings and specific embodiment the utility model is described in further detail.
Described in the utility model a kind of position shearing device as shown in Figure 1;The position shearing device includes two The individual position shearing mechanism for setting that is connected up and down;The position shearing mechanism includes bracket axle 1, bracket 2, the alignment pin 3, seat of honour 4th, trundle 5, lower axle 6, installing plate bearing block 7, installing plate 8, the small axis of guide 9, step 10, Cutter apron 11, tangent line cylinder 12nd, upper cutter 13, lower tool rest 14, lower cutter 15 and pin 16;The bracket axle 1 is provided with bracket 2;Set in the bracket 2 There are multiple alignment pins 3;The top of the bracket 2 is provided with the trundle 5 positioned at the lower end of the seat of honour 4;Lower axle 6 is provided with the seat of honour 4; The upper end of the lower axle 6 is connected by installing plate bearing block 7 with installing plate 8;The lower end of the installing plate 8 is by the small axis of guide 9 with Bearing block 10 is connected;The step 10 is connected by Cutter apron 11 with lower axle 6;The installing plate 8 and step 10 it Between be additionally provided with tangent line cylinder 12, and the expansion link of tangent line cylinder 12 points to step 10;The Cutter apron 11 is provided with to be cut Knife 13;The lower end of the upper cutter 13 is provided with the lower cutter 15 on lower tool rest 14;The lower tool rest 14 is connected with the seat of honour 4;Institute State the pin 16 being additionally provided with lower tool rest 14 positioned at the both sides of lower cutter 15.
When actually used, the utility model with push whirligig coordinate, can disposably by two motor stators simultaneously Fix, coiling treatment then is carried out to motor stator, after coiling is machined, copper cash can be relied on pin, then tangent line Cylinder is opened, and tangent line air cylinder driven step moves down, and the Cutter apron being so located on step also moves down, this The lower cutter on upper cutter and lower tool rest on sample Cutter apron contacts with each other, and copper cash is cut off, so as to complete the winding of copper cash.
